Details

Extended area black body is defined by the large emitting surface area precise temperature control with good uniformity. Tempsens make Blackbodies are state of the art, highly accurate and stable with different standard sizes and temperature ranges. The LBBCH Series Extended Area black bodies are low temperature infrared reference sources operating either in absolute or differential mode.

A recirculation chiller unit cools a black body to approximately the desire temprature and electronic control system and heaters unit assembly of thermoelectric coolers further control the black body surface temperature precisely and accurately to the desired set point.

Specifications

SPECIFICATIONS

Parameter LBBCH (-40°C to 100°C)
LBBCH100 LBBCH200
Emissive area 100 x 100mm2 200 x 200mm2
Temperature Range -40° to 100°C -40° to 100°C
Emissive area uniformity (1) ±0.2@50°C ±0.2@50°C
Emissivity 0.98 ±0.02 0.98 ±0.02
Stability ±0.1°C ±0.1°C
Display Resolution 0.1°C 0.1°C
Method of control Digital self tuned PID Controller Digital self tuned PID Controller
Head dimensions (mm3) 300(H) x 320(W) x 190 (D)mm 450(H) x 360(W) x 305(D)mm
Head Weight 15 KG 30 KG
Chiller Unit dimensions
(mm3)
620(H) x 410(W) x 600 (D)mm 620(H) x 410(W) x 600 (D)mm
Chiller Unit Weight 50 KG 50 KG
Max. power consumption 2 KW 2.5 KW
Powersupply 230VAC, 1ph. 50Hz 230VAC, 1ph. 50Hz
Remote control Ethernet/RS-232 Ethernet/RS-232
Operating Temperature
Range (head)
10°C to +25°C 10°C to +25°C

 

*1 at 80% of emissive area
*At Ambient 23°C
